Output e81e037389c7d551a34a5322e8046c6c248f962c52a219d4ae9365604998ee60:1

value
846011596
script pubkey
OP_0 OP_PUSHBYTES_20 ce2e51b9e4e6e8076d2cc0c41fa8746ba26ccbaa
address
tb1qech9rw0yum5qwmfvcrzpl2r5dw3xeja25g2028
transaction
e81e037389c7d551a34a5322e8046c6c248f962c52a219d4ae9365604998ee60